I did good this weekend but then had too many stress snacks at work. I need to have a better plan in mind for these… like I won’t have the doughnut but instead I will later do something else. I’ve decided for now that thing is to go get some mint tea. If I still want the treat after half of the tea is gone, okay. I’ll see how this goes. No donuts, chocolate, chips, or other similar things until after I get and drink some of the tea.
Too many sweet snacks that I feel I “needed” but I really can’t tell why.
I’ve found one thing that helps is to have something booked to really look forward too – like a class or movie or something. That helps lighten my need for the “comfort” that lead to eating.
